Helena Braga is a prominent Portuguese physicist known for her significant contributions to the field of solid-state batteries. She is affiliated with the Faculty of Engineering at the University of Porto and has collaborated with Nobel Prize laureate John Goodenough to develop and patent a new type of solid glass electrolyte, which has shown high ionic conductivity at room temperature and enhanced stability, paving the way for safer and more efficient solid-state battery technologies.
